Define permanent magnet
A permanent magnet is a piece of ferromagnetic material (like as iron, nickel or cobalt) which has properties of attracting several pieces of these materials. A permanent magnet will position itself in a north and south direction when liberally suspended. The north-seeking end of the magnet is known as the north pole, N, and the south-seraching end the south pole, S.
